MATCHROOM POOL ACQUIRES WORLD 9-BALL CHAMPIONSHIP

Matchroom Pool has acquired the rights in perpetuity to host the World 9-Ball Championship from 2020 in a ground-breaking agreement with the WPA.

The World 9-Ball Championship joins Matchroom Pool’s portfolio of major events and will benefit from increased prize money and global TV coverage. The 2020 World 9-Ball Championship will be staged from Wednesday, October 14 until Sunday, October 18 at a venue to be announced in due course.

Matchroom Pool previously staged the World 9-Ball Championship from 1999 to 2008 and will apply its world-renowned promotion, TV production and arena staging to this prestigious event.

Matchroom Sport Chairman and BCA Hall of Fame promoter Barry Hearn said: “This is great news for pool fans and pool players all over the world. We are making a big push on 9-ball pool and we’ve had a lot of success over the last 12 months, particularly with the US Open which was sensational in Las Vegas. But this will be even bigger for the world of pool.

“We’ll have 128 players, prize money will go up, the event will be open to men and women and it will be televised all over the world. This is a major addition to Matchroom Pool and I think a real huge benefit to pool players and pool fans all around the world.

Lely To Captain Team Europe

Alex Lely has been appointed as the new captain of Team Europe at the partypoker Mosconi Cup, with Karl Boyes as his vice-captain. Europe will be looking to regain the Cup at Alexandra Palace, London this December 1st-4th after suffering back-to-back defeats against USA.

Dutchman Lely returns to the helm having been European captain in 2008 and 2009. In his first Cup as captain he led Europe to an 11-5 victory in Malta before losing 11-7 to USA the following year.

“It is very exciting,” said Lely of his appointment. “It has been ten years since I was last the captain and that is a long time in the context of the Mosconi Cup. It has grown to be so big in that time and it is getting better every year. With USA winning it the last two years, the Mosconi Cup has sparks once again.

“We have a big pool of talent in Europe. We have two wildcards so together with Karl Boyes we will need to make the right choices to compliment the three players who qualify through the rankings. There will be a list of usual suspects and new contenders we have to consider. One new contender to consider would have to be Fedor Gorst, who came really close to making the team last year and is now World Champion.

Ultimate Team Gear Announced As Official Merchadise Partner Of Matchroom Pool

Matchroom Pool and Ultimate Team Gear are thrilled to announce an expansion of the partnership between the two companies, which sees Ultimate Team Gear become the Official Merchandise Partner of Matchroom Pool.

Ultimate Team Gear (UTG) has been the Official Apparel Partner of the partypoker Mosconi Cup since 2015 and has also supplied player jerseys and staff clothing for the World Pool Masters, World Cup of Pool and US Open 9-Ball Championship in recent years.

UTG have established themselves as the number one name in tournament pool clothing over the last decade. Renowned for their stylish and colorful designs, UTG will continue to produce two different shirts for each team at the partypoker Mosconi Cup, as well as official jerseys for all Matchroom Pool events.

The new long-term agreement expands the partnership across all merchandise and means fans will soon be able to purchase replica jerseys and much more online at UltimateTeamGear.com and on site at the US Open 9-Ball Championship and partypoker Mosconi Cup.

Emily Frazer, COO of Matchroom Pool, said: “As we expand our Matchroom Pool brand and stable of events, it is important to work with great and consistent partners. Ultimate Team Gear undoubtably design and produce the best and most creative jersey’s in the industry.

Buckley Starts 2020 in Style

Report by: Matt Hawthorn
Photos by: Shaun Berrisford

On Saturday 4th January 2020 the 24 highest ranked Cyclop Pool Series participants were invited back to Rileys Sports Bar Solihull for our series Grand Final. This event would see our highest pay-outs of the series, with a prize fund of £1600 broken down as follows : winner £600, R.Up £300, Semis £150, Quarters £100. Live streaming, and commentary, came courtesy of Extreme Q Sport TV. All players were polled beforehand, with the option of playing either 9 Ball or 10 Ball on the day. The majority voted for 10 Ball. All matches were a race to 7, subject to handicaps, played to a modified double elimination format with the top eight ranked players seeded and given a bye through to the second round.

The 8 seeded qualifiers were (ranking points in brackets) : Luke Garland (149), Kev Simpson (145), Benji Buckley (128), Alan Coton (127), Ian McCormik (114), Andy Lacey (109), Shane Conroy (108) and Ryan Coton (103).

The following sixteen players would enter the competition in the first round: Elliott Sanderson (95), Carl Weaver (93), Raffy Gonzales (92), Daryl Garland (92), Kris Kovacs (92), Steve Weaver (88), Keith Walkerdine (88), Kurt Weaver (87), Andy Carter (87), Chris Seville (84), Chris Parker (84), Mark Eardley (83), Ryan Wissett (74), Danny Douane (74), Shaun Berrisford (69) and Romy Roque (63). Unfortunately, Chris Seville and Romy Roque were unable to attend but their spots were filled by the 25th and 26th ranked players, Alan Morgan and Matt Hawthorn.

Tiger Products Signs Darren “Dynamite” Appleton as an Ambassador for Tiger Tips!

Tiger Products is excited to announce its signing of BCA Hall of Famer, Darren “Dynamite” Appleton as an ambassador for Tiger Tips!

“I’m absolutely delighted and excited to be working with Tiger. I think it’s something that has been in the works for many years and now seemed like the perfect time to join forces,” said Appleton.

For over 20 years, Tiger tips have set world records, helped win world championships and been the most used amongst professionals. All proudly made in the USA, Tiger tips continue to be the epitome of what Tiger Products stands for: Craftsmanship, innovation and technology.

“I started out with Everest tips many years ago and loved the consistency of the tip. It never really lost its control, even after many months of use. Unlike most tips I’ve used over the years,” Appleton said. “The Sniper hits so easy as well, so I’m looking forward to playing with these tips in the future and actually think it’s a perfect fit for my style of play.”

“We are very excited to have Darren on board with the Tiger Team. He is a true professional in every sense of the word. His resume speaks for itself and his overall generosity and kindness are why we feel he will be a great addition to the Tiger Team and the perfect representative for our Tiger tips,” said Tiger CEO, Tony Kalamdaryan.

Kingdom Adds 9-Ball to Grass Roots Sports Portfolio

Saudi Arabia has announced it will host the 2020 World Cup of Pool, which will run from the 23rd-28th June 2020 in Jeddah.

Sanctioned by the WPA, the World Cup of Pool will present 32 two-player teams from 31 countries with players selected by qualifying criteria and qualification events which will take place globally. As host nation, Saudi Arabia will enter two teams to be selected by the Saudi Arabian Billiards and Snooker Federation.

The World Cup of Pool has been an established major event in 9-ball since 2006 and adopts a straight-knockout format. Matches are race to 7 in the first two rounds, race to 9 in the quarter-finals and semi-finals, and race to 11 in the final.

Austrian pair Albin Ouschan and Mario He are defending champions having won the trophy for a second time in 2019. Previous winners of the World Cup of Pool include Philippines, China and USA.

The newly formed partnership with Matchroom Pool kick starts a ten-year agreement, throughout which the Kingdom aims to raise the profile of pool at grass roots level by way of coaching visits, player appearances and school seminars.

Prince Abdulaziz Bin Turki AlFaisal Al Saud, Chairman of the GSA, said: “The 2020 World Cup of Pool is another significant step for the Kingdom, that showcases our to desire to open up as welcoming hosts to a diverse mix of world-class sporting events, while also offering the people of Saudi Arabia a chance to be inspired to play a vast array of sports all year-round.

GORST THE GREAT!

19 year old Fedor Gorst of Russia wins the 2019 World 9-ball Championship with a hard fought 13 -11 win over Taiwan’s Chang Jung Lin in Doha.


Story and Photos By Ted Lerner
WPA Media Officer

Playing with a poise, calm and skill that clearly belied his 19 years of age, Russia’s Fedor Gorst won the 2019 World 9-ball Championship today in Doha, Qatar, defeating a stingy Chang Jung Lin of Taiwan, 13-11.

The match was nothing short of a brutal marathon, lasting four hours, and the slow, grinding style of Chang only added to the supreme test of pressure and drama that seemed to accompany every rack. That Gorst was able to suck it all up against one of the greats of the last 15 years, and withstand the inevitable emotional peaks and valleys that come in a long, tiring match, will surely add to the satisfaction the young Russian must surely be feeling. There were several lead changes, and the more experienced Chang grabbed the momentum midway through. But Gorst persevered and grabbed the momentum back when it counted most, and close it out in style.

The win by Gorst will surely be extremely pleasing to his many fans. Not only is the low key and friendly Russian easy to root for, but his hard work and prodigious talent have, for the last few years, portended greatness. That Gorst pulled off the ultimate prize in pool at just 19 years of age is an absolutely stunning feat, and bodes amazingly well for the young man’s future, and for European pool as well.

For Chang, the loss was clearly a bitter disappointment that will sting for the foreseeable future. The 2012 World 8-ball champion has been one of pool’s most consistent and successful players over the last 15 years. But the World 9-ball Championship was the one title he has wanted the most. Winning in the pool world is so tough and so brutal, that opportunities like this don’t often come your way. Chang’s demeanor afterwards spoke of his realization that he let the ultimate prize slip out of his hands.

The marathon final came on the heels of two long semi-finals matches played concurrently earlier in the day. In one semi-final Gorst matched up with World 10-ball Champion Ko Ping Chung in a fascinating battle of two of the sports finest young talents. Most fans had “Little” Ko the favorite as he had look implacable over the last 4 days. But Gorst proved to be the more resilient on this day. With little between them the first half of the match, It was the Russian who outwitted the Taiwanese winning in strong showing, 11-7.

The other semi-final featured Chang against China’s Lui Haitao in a battle of hard core grinders. Chang took an early lead and never once fell behind. Playing his methodical and calculating style, Chang turned the screws throughout and won in a relative breeze, 11-5.

The final presented the ideal story line for fans to sink their teeth into: the wily 34 year old veteran finally on the brink of capturing the sport's most coveted title, taking on the 19 year old upstart looking to become the second youngest player to ever win the World 9-ball title.
